Unica Zürn was a German writer and artist known for her
surrealist works. 'Dark Spring' is a collection of her
writings that explore themes of mental illness, identity,
and the subconscious.

The Context of Unica Zürn’s Artistic Journey
Unica Zürn’s career unfolded against the backdrop of post-war Europe, a time marked by
upheaval, existential questioning, and a blossoming of avant-garde art movements. Born
in 1916, Zürn’s life was interwoven with intense personal struggles, including mental
health challenges, which profoundly influenced her artistic productions. The phrase “dark
spring” metaphorically captures a phase characterized by both creative fertility and
psychological turbulence.
Her works, especially her anagram poems and intricate ink drawings, reveal a consistent
engagement with themes of identity, transformation, and the unconscious mind. The
“dark spring” can be interpreted as a period during which these themes coalesced into a
particularly intense and evocative body of work, embodying a contrast between renewal
and darkness.

Comparative Insights: Unica Zürn and Contemporary Surrealists
When placing Unica Zürn’s dark spring creations alongside works by contemporaries such
as Hans Bellmer or Leonora Carrington, distinct differences emerge. Zürn’s art is often
more introspective, with a pronounced focus on self-portraiture and the internal
landscape, whereas Bellmer’s work tends toward overt eroticism and Carrington’s toward
mythic narratives.
Moreover, Zürn’s anagram poetry complements her visual art, providing a linguistic layer
to her surreal explorations. This duality of mediums underscores the multifaceted nature
of the dark spring phase, highlighting her as a multidisciplinary figure within surrealism.
